Output 68376b765343d97cde12d2ed99df676bc9355bf85bf26892bb3d1f58a706686d:1

value
172682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a29ca38b19f3269536526eab439efb4583eb958 OP_EQUAL
address
3QVkv7hvgrAKz2Fr5FDeeTqPYk99ZWkWYC
transaction
68376b765343d97cde12d2ed99df676bc9355bf85bf26892bb3d1f58a706686d
spent
true